feat(atis): clock-locked ATIS loop tied to tuned frequency

Real ATIS broadcasts run continuously; tuning in mid-broadcast should
drop the pilot into the current spoken position, then loop. The frontend
now generates the full announcement once via TTS, plays it as a looping
HTMLAudioElement, and seeks to ((Date.now() - lastUpdated) / duration)
on metadata-load so all clients tuned to the same ATIS hear it phase-
synced. The loop starts/stops automatically with frequency tuning and
restarts on info-letter change. say.post.ts now caches tag=atis like
tag=flightlab to avoid re-synthesizing identical announcements.
